SCIA Engineer 22 is a significant release in the field of structural analysis and design software, particularly for engineers and architects who focus on building design, bridges, and industrial structures. SCIA Engineer is a comprehensive software solution developed by SCIA, a company known for its expertise in structural analysis and design. This software is used globally for its robust capabilities in finite element analysis, dynamic analysis, and design of structures according to various international standards.

Similar to modern operating systems, SCIA Engineer 22 introduces an intelligent search functionality. By hitting a simple shortcut, you can type any command, material properties, or help topic, and the software executes it instantly.
